Pavers Hardscaping in Fairfield County, CT
Pavers hardscaping services involve the installation and design of durable, attractive surfaces using interlocking paving stones, concrete pavers, or natural stone. These services are commonly used for creating patios, walkways, driveways, pool decks, and outdoor seating areas. Property owners often seek these solutions to enhance curb appeal, improve outdoor functionality, and add value to their homes. Understanding the different materials available, the scope of the project, and the desired aesthetic are important considerations before requesting pavers hardscaping work.
Homeowners typically want to know about the variety of paver styles, colors, and patterns available to match their property’s design. They may also inquire about the durability and maintenance requirements of different materials, as well as the installation process and how it impacts existing landscaping. Clarifying these details helps ensure the chosen hardscaping solutions meet both aesthetic preferences and practical needs for long-lasting outdoor spaces.

Common Pavers Hardscaping Jobs
Patio Installations - durable paver patios enhance outdoor living spaces for entertaining and relaxation.
Walkway Construction - functional and attractive paver walkways improve property accessibility and curb appeal.
Driveway Paving - sturdy paver driveways provide long-lasting surfaces that withstand heavy use.
Pool Decks - slip-resistant paver pool decks create safe, stylish areas around swimming pools.
Retaining Walls - paver retaining walls help manage slopes and add structural interest to landscape designs.
Stepping Stones - decorative paver stepping stones create charming pathways through gardens and yards.
Pavers Hardscaping Questions
What are pavers used for in hardscaping? Pavers are commonly used to create durable pat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as that enhance property appeal.
What materials are available for pavers? Pavers come in a variety of materials including brick, concrete, and natural stone, offering different textures and styles to suit any outdoor space.
How do pavers improve outdoor spaces? Pavers provide a stable, attractive surface that can define areas, improve drainage, and add value to the property’s landscape.
What maintenance is needed for paver installations? Regular cleaning and occasional re-sanding help maintain the appearance and stability of paver surfaces over time.
